Biographical Information

Aldo C. Leopold was born in Albuquerque, New Mexico, and grew up in Madison, Wisconsin. Leopold attended the University of Wisconsin, served in the Marine Corps, and completed graduate studies at Harvard University. He then became a staff member of Purdue University where he remained for 25 years. After leaving Purdue, he moved to the University of Nebraska, where he was an administrator, and later to Cornell University. Leopold retired in 1990 as Emeritus W.H. Crocker Scientist at the Boyce Thompson Institute at Cornell.
